On Wed, 2023-10-18 at 09:34 +0800, chenglulu wrote:
>
> 在 2023/10/17 下午10:24, WANG Xuerui 写道:
> >
> > On 10/17/23 22:06, Xi Ruoyao wrote:
> > > During the review of a LLVM change [1], on LA464 we found that zeroing
> > "an" LLVM change (because the word LLVM is pronounced letter-by-letter)
> > >
在 2023/10/17 下午10:24, WANG Xuerui 写道:
On 10/17/23 22:06, Xi Ruoyao wrote:
During the review of a LLVM change [1], on LA464 we found that zeroing
"an" LLVM change (because the word LLVM is pronounced letter-by-letter)
a fcc with fcmp.caf.s is much faster than a movgr2cf from $r0.
On 10/17/23 22:06, Xi Ruoyao wrote:
During the review of a LLVM change [1], on LA464 we found that zeroing
"an" LLVM change (because the word LLVM is pronounced letter-by-letter)
a fcc with fcmp.caf.s is much faster than a movgr2cf from $r0.
Similarly, "an" fcc
[1]:
During the review of a LLVM change [1], on LA464 we found that zeroing
a fcc with fcmp.caf.s is much faster than a movgr2cf from $r0.
[1]: https://github.com/llvm/llvm-project/pull/69300
gcc/ChangeLog:
* config/loongarch/loongarch.md (movfcc): Use fcmp.caf.s for
zeroing a fcc.